There has been much speculation about how the upcoming World Cup 2010 in South Africa will benefit the country, and the region, in terms of economic development. All across Southern African entrepreneurs and business people are getting ready to cash in on the mega-event. Yet, for women, the likely benefits are questionable. One key area is that entrepreneurship requires access to credit and finance, resources that tend to be less available for women than men.
